The Labor Relations Department seeks an Investigator for the Production Workplace Investigations (“PWI”) team, a unit within the Labor Relations Department. PWI’s function is to conduct objective, balanced, and thorough investigations into complaints of alleged misconduct or policy violations by production or represented facility employees. These employees are mainly located in North America, and represented by a variety of industry unions, including, but not limited to:
The nature of employee complaints include, but are not limited to, harassment & discrimination; insubordination; bullying or hostile work environment; retaliation; drugs & alcohol; conflict of interest; verbal altercations; threats and violence in the workplace; misappropriation of company property or theft. PWI promotes and advocates for consistency of resolutions and disciplinary action following an investigation and partners with Employment Counsel, People & Culture Partners, and other key stakeholders to resolve complex employment issues.
